Dispute with the Doctors

Material, technology: oil, canvas

Size: 424 x 195 cm

Description: The elegant vaulting and curtain, the restraint in the rendering of the figures, their lucid grouping suggest the painter’s bent for classicism. Inscriptions and documents reveal that Antonio Zanchi was contracted to paint five pictures for the cathedral of Capodistria (Istria) on July 15, 1679. He was paid 1240 lire on November 10 for "Dispute with the Doctors" and "The baptism of Christ", and another 1468 lire on April 30, 1780, for the "Marriage in Cana", "The healing of the paralytic" and the "Flagellation" (presumably mistaken for the "Cleansing of the Temple"). The "Marriage at Cana" with reminiscences of Tintoretto and Veronese is still in its place, on the north wall of the cathedral choir, and the "The healing of the paralytic" of lying format, composed with the robust back of a nude as its centre, is preserved at the Academy in Vienna.
